Laborious Days Poem by KarlRomeo PierreLouis

Laborious Days



There is no bravery here
Just hollow memories lay plain
Laid bare for all to see
No glare or fanfare, just pain
There is no bravery here
Behind these eyes, behind these sighs
Just the care-coiled touches of strangers
Buried helplessly beside the sadness
There is no bravery here
Written or dreamed about
Not stories or fairytales, just farewells
Covered well with seasoned roses
And faded preachers
There is no bravery here
To holler or scream aloud
Just the breeze of fallen leaves and such
Not much, but the crossing sounds of the lost
Daylight and nightfall
There is no bravery here
Beyond the remembered
Below the sunset
Beneath the clutter

Laborious days
